Abstract

A surgical devices comprises a roll-up wound protector with a distal ring, a proximal ring, and a flexible sleeve having a length extending between the proximal and distal rings. The proximal ring has proximal, distal, medial, and lateral faces and is rollable to gather the flexible sleeve around the proximal ring and shorten the length of the flexible sleeve. A hand access port comprises a frame circumscribing an aperture. The aperture is aligned with the proximal and distal rings and is adapted to receive and seal against a surgeon's arm. A latching mechanism is connected to the frame and circumscribes the proximal ring, the latching mechanism having an engaged state wherein the hand access port is attached to the proximal ring and a disengaged state wherein the hand access port is not attached to the proximal ring. An actuation ring is operably connected to the latching mechanism to select between the engaged and disengaged states.

Claims (21)

1. A surgical device, comprising:

a) a roll-up wound protector comprising a distal ring, a proximal ring, and a flexible sleeve having a length extending between the proximal and distal rings, the proximal ring having proximal, distal, medial, and lateral faces, the medial and lateral faces each comprising a circumferential recess, the proximal ring being rollable to gather the flexible sleeve around the proximal ring and shorten the length of the flexible sleeve;

b) a hand access port comprising a frame circumscribing an aperture, the aperture being aligned with the proximal and distal rings and being adapted to receive and seal against a surgeon's arm;

c) a latching mechanism connected to the frame and circumscribing the proximal ring, the latching mechanism having an engaged state wherein the latching mechanism engages the proximal ring at the circumferential recess in the lateral face to attach the frame to the proximal ring and a disengaged state wherein the latching mechanism disengages the proximal ring to detach the frame from the proximal ring; and

d) an actuation ring moveable relative the frame, the actuation ring being operably connected to the latching mechanism to select between the engaged and disengaged states.

2. The surgical device of claim 1 , wherein the actuation ring circumscribes the latching mechanism.

3. The surgical device of claim 1 , wherein the proximal ring has a figure eight cross sectional geometry.

4. The surgical device of claim 1 , wherein the proximal ring further comprises wire inserts.

5. The surgical device of claim 1 , wherein the hand access port comprises a flexible and compliant pad.

6. The surgical device of claim 5 , wherein the pad is a foam material.

7. The surgical device of claim 5 , wherein the pad is a gel material.

8. The surgical device of claim 1 , wherein the hand access port comprises an iris valve.

9. The surgical device of claim 1 , wherein the latching mechanism comprises a plurality of resiliently deflectable tabs attached to the frame.

10. The surgical device of claim 1 , wherein the actuation ring is axially actuated.

11. The surgical device of claim 1 , wherein the actuation ring is rotationally actuated.

12. The surgical device of claim 1 , wherein the actuation ring comprises cam surfaces.

13. The surgical device of claim 1 , wherein the latching mechanism comprises means for latching to the proximal ring.

14. A method of processing a device for surgery, comprising:

a) obtaining the surgical device of claim 1 ;

b) sterilizing the surgical device; and

c) storing the surgical device in a sterile container.
